Most business owners think that remote working is the future, according
to a recent report.
The report found that office workers have handled the transition
to remote working very well and that more than half of them feel
that they are more productive than before. Two-thirds expect some
form of remote working to continue for at least another three months.
And most of them would not be surprised if remote working continued
for another six months.
These findings only go to show how successful remote working has
been for most companies and their employees. For the majority of
businesses the transition to remote working has been surprisingly
smooth. This is largely due to the availability of reliable and
effective remote working solutions.
